    Abstract

    A coherent anti-Stokes Raman spectrometer using near-infrared optical parametric oscillators is reported. It scans over a wide frequency range of 0-7000 cm-1 (0-210 THz). Sensitive detection of THz-frequency vibrational modes of protein in aqueous solution is successfully achieved.
